Most common problems, symptoms & fixes for the XUD9BTF engine.

Engine XUD9BTF commonly faces injector pump wear, turbocharger issues, and EGR valve clogging. Diagnose by checking for rough idling, loss of power, or excessive smoke. Prevent problems with regular oil changes using quality oil and timely fuel filter replacements to avoid injector damage. Inspect and clean the EGR valve periodically to maintain emissions and performance. Turbocharger failures often stem from oil starvation; ensure proper oil levels and change intervals. If the injector pump fails, professional rebuilding or replacement is necessary. Addressing these proactively extends engine life and reliability in the specified Citroen and Peugeot models.
